160 elderly people in northern My Loc district of Nam Dinh province have had their sight restored thanks to crystalline lens replacements.

The free eye operations were organised by Nam Dinh’s province’s Department of Health in conjunction with the World Health Organisation (WHO), the Central Eye Hospital and My Loc district’s General Hospital .

The Director of the provincial Department of Health Dang Thi Minh, said that the free eye surgery and lens replacements are provided annually as part of the WHO’s efforts to support the northern province .

The cost of an ordinary operation is approximately 4-5 million VND, however the WHO has funded the programme including after care for patients who have had surgery.

The operations using Phaco technique were conducted by top surgeons from the Central Eye Hospital and took only 5 minutes each.

Over the last two years, the WHO’s programme on crystalline lens surgery has brought sight back to more than 1,200 elderly people in four districts of Nam Dinh including My Loc, Vu Ban, Y Yen, and Hai Hau.-VNA
